OECD cuts its forecast for global economic growth

The Organization for Economic Cooperation and Development on Wednesday cut its forecast for 2019 global economic growth to 3.3% from its November forecast of 3.5%, citing worries around China and Europe. "Economic prospects are now weaker in nearly all G20 countries than previously anticipated.
